Output c62b3c6149f9630c9cffa7ee53ae4444f8579479aec69f8a97d7e82bab20b529:1

value
173690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f339eaa0851518f9e5ea11f89d171b48c67012 OP_EQUAL
address
39FchvqV4zyPRfrWY5uJLGxbEvs1zADm4A
transaction
c62b3c6149f9630c9cffa7ee53ae4444f8579479aec69f8a97d7e82bab20b529
spent
true